'No One Works Harder Than Akash Singh': Justin Langer After LSG’s Big Win Over CSK
Akash played a key role in the victory with figures of 3-26, removing Ruturaj Gaikwad, Sanju Samson, and Urvil Patel to put CSK under pressure early in the innings.
Speaking after the match, Langer said Akash fully deserved his success because of the effort he put into improving his game.
